INTERNSHIPS AT HEALTHLINE:
We don’t believe in busywork, and we definitely don’t believe in wasting time or talent on “getting coffee.” As a Healthline Intern, you’ll be expected to contribute new ideas, take ownership of meaningful projects, and make a real impact on our business.
Typically, Healthline Interns own 1-2 large projects over the summer. With guidance from your manager, you’ll drive strategy, build tests, pivot, improve, and iterate until finally presenting results to your business team and senior leadership at the end of the summer. 
Our culture is built on feedback, and our Interns are no different. You’ll receive two structured performance reviews over the summer, where your manager will work with you to identify key strengths, opportunities, and goals. Top-performing interns will be eligible for full-time offers at the end of the summer.
WHAT'S THE ROLE:
In this internship, you will be assisting our Parenthood team, one of our health and wellness brands, in creating engaging and high-trafficked content for site and social platforms!
Healthline Parenthood, Healthline Media’s new outlet, is designed as a resource to help parents address their health and well-being while also tending to their expanded family. 
  • Assist teams (SEO, features) with article production
  • Write high-quality articles according to best practices and in-house style guides
  • Do first edits on articles
  • Assist with project work like executing SEO content improvements
  • Brainstorm and pitch content or social ideas

Healthline.com is the fastest growing health information brand, the 2nd largest health site in the US (per comScore) and reaches over 200 million people a month globally. The business is high growth and solidly profitable, employing ~300 people in San Francisco, New York and the UK. We are a purpose-driven organization with a vision to create a stronger, healthier world.  
Healthline is a certified Great Place to Work and has been named to the Top 5 in Ad Age's Best Places to Work in 2019. Check out these links to learn more about what it's like to work at Healthline Media. 
Founded in 2000, Red Ventures is a portfolio of growing digital businesses that bring consumers and brands together through integrated e-commerce, strategic partnerships and many proprietary brands including Healthline, Bankrate, AllConnect.com and Reviews.com. Headquartered south of Charlotte, NC, Red Ventures has over 3000 employees in offices across the US, as well as London and Sao Paulo.
